Cafe Rico

Location:
100m south of (or one block behind) El Parquecito beach.
Puerto Viejo, Costa Rica

Restaurant Types:
Café

By Ruth Bell

 Tucked away behind El Parquecito, this lovely café is surrounded by tropical plants and full of atmosphere. You'll feel instantly welcome going into the open, wooden café to order your (highly recommended) breakfast plate and freshly brewed coffee. Most popular is the "Ana Rosa," a special that includes potatoes, eggs, cheese, bacon and avocado ($5).  Accommodation, book exchange, surf and bike rental and laundry services are also on offer. Look out for tropical frogs in the garden and the sloth, who occasionally naps in the tree outside.

Open from 6 a.m. to 2 p.m., but closed on Wednesdays.
